A commercial water treatment quotation is an engineering document, not a price list. To produce one that will still be accurate at commissioning, we need to know what we are treating, how much of it, and what you need out the other end.

The single most useful thing you can send is a current water analysis report. If you do not have one, that is fine — a site water test can be arranged as part of the pre-quotation survey, and for larger requirements it is complimentary.

What you get back is a specification-backed proposal: itemised equipment with makes and models, guaranteed output quality at your stated feed condition, capex and five-year operating cost, scope boundaries stated clearly, and AMC terms with response times. That is what a procurement team can actually evaluate and approve.

What to send us

  • Water analysis report if available — minimum TDS, pH, total hardness, chlorides, iron and turbidity.
  • Daily requirement in litres, and the hours over which you need it produced.
  • Application — drinking water, process water, boiler feed, product water, dialysis, or a combination.
  • Site location and available space, with any constraint on plant room dimensions.
  • Available electrical supply: phase, sanctioned load, and reliability.
  • Existing equipment to integrate with — storage tanks, coolers, chillers, distribution.
  • Timeline, and whether you are evaluating capex purchase, rental or AMC-inclusive models.

How the technical site audit works

For requirements above roughly 500 LPH, a site visit is the right way to produce a quotation you can rely on. It covers feed water sampling and testing, space and drainage assessment, electrical availability, integration points with existing equipment, and a review of your actual demand profile against what you estimated.

Sites frequently discover during this process that their assumed requirement was wrong in a way that materially changes the specification — peaked demand needing storage rather than capacity, or feed water needing iron removal nobody had accounted for. Finding that before purchase is the entire point.

Installation, commissioning and service response

Commercial buyers are buying uptime, so the commercial terms matter as much as the equipment specification. Insist on these being written into the purchase order rather than discussed verbally.

  • Site survey and feed-water analysis before the final quotation — never accept a specification produced without a water report.
  • Defined commissioning scope: civil and electrical prerequisites, who supplies what, and a documented performance test at handover.
  • Written service response times, with escalation, and clarity on whether spares are held locally.
  • Operator training and a laminated SOP left on site, so routine flushing and cartridge changes do not depend on one person.
  • Warranty terms stated separately for membranes, pumps, vessels and instrumentation, because they differ.

Treatment architecture

  1. 1

    Pre-treatment module

    Multigrade sand and activated carbon filtration strips suspended solids, turbidity and chlorine that would otherwise oxidise the RO membrane.

  2. 2

    Softening / antiscalant dosing

    Protects membranes from calcium and magnesium scaling. On hard feed water this stage is not optional — it determines membrane life.

  3. 3

    High-pressure RO module

    Heavy-duty booster pumps drive feed water through industrial spiral-wound membranes at 12-18 bar in an array sized for your recovery target.

  4. 4

    Post-treatment disinfection

    UV disinfection and ozonation, with mineral dosing where potable taste and consistency matter.

  5. 5

    Microprocessor / PLC controls

    Auto start-stop on tank level, dry-run protection, high and low pressure cut-offs, and timed membrane flushing — with data logging on industrial plants.

What is the typical lead time for commercial installation?
Standard commercial systems from 100 to 500 LPH are typically installed within 48-72 hours of site readiness, since they are skid-built and largely pre-assembled. Custom industrial plants generally need 7-14 days depending on site readiness, civil work, electrical provisioning and whether non-standard materials such as SS-316 wetted parts are specified.
Do you offer Annual Maintenance Contracts (AMC)?
Yes. Commercial installations can be covered by comprehensive AMC packages including scheduled preventive visits, membrane and cartridge replacement, and priority breakdown response. Comprehensive AMC (parts included) typically runs 10-14% of capital cost annually; non-comprehensive (labour and visits only) runs 5-8%. Get the inclusions listed line by line before signing.
Can the system integrate with our existing overhead tanks, coolers or chillers?
Yes. Commercial systems use high-pressure sensors and level-based auto start-stop, which allows plug-and-play integration with external storage tanks, water coolers and chillers. Tell us your existing tank capacity, height and any chiller model at enquiry stage so the pump head and control logic are specified correctly.
What water analysis do you need before quoting?
At minimum: TDS, pH, total hardness, chlorides, iron and turbidity. For industrial applications also silica, sulphates, and microbiological load. If you do not have a current report, a site water test can be arranged as part of the pre-quotation survey — specifying a plant without one is guesswork and usually results in a mis-sized pre-treatment train.
Do you handle high-TDS and brackish feed water?
Yes. Brackish water RO configurations handle feed water well above standard municipal input — commonly specified up to 3,000+ ppm, and higher with two-pass or seawater-class membranes. High-TDS feed changes the membrane selection, the pump pressure, the recovery ratio and the reject volume, so it must be established before design rather than after.
